Understanding the Car Ignition System
The Ignition Barrel Replacement Cost system ignites the air-fuel mix in the engine's cylinders, enabling combustion and the production of power. This system consists of a number of key components, consisting of:
Ignition Coil: Converts the battery's low voltage to the thousands of volts required to create a stimulate.Ignition Switch: Activates the Ignition Barrel Replacement Cost system when you turn the Key Ignition Repair or push a button.Trigger Plugs: Deliver the electrical charge to the engine's cylinders for combustion.Distributor: (in older vehicles) directs the high-voltage current to the suitable trigger plugs.Signs You Need Ignition Replacement
Recognizing the indications of ignition system failure is the first step towards looking for replacement. Here are some typical indications:
Difficulty Starting the Engine: The car cranks however does not begin.Engine Stalls: The engine might begin and after that all of a sudden turned off.Misfiring: The engine runs unevenly or misfires throughout velocity.Warning Lights: The check engine light illuminates, showing possible ignition concerns.Typical Cost of Ignition Replacement
The cost of car ignition replacement can vary based on numerous aspects, including the make and design of the automobile, labor expenses, and the specific parts needed. Below is a basic breakdown of expenses associated with ignition replacement:
ComponentCost Range (GBP)Ignition Switch₤ 100 - ₤ 250Ignition Coil₤ 50 - ₤ 150Spark Plug Replacement₤ 10 - ₤ 30 per plugLabor Costs₤ 50 - ₤ 100 per hour
Approximated Total Cost: For a total ignition system replacement, car owners can expect to pay in between ₤ 300 to ₤ 800, depending upon the complexity of the task.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. For how long does ignition replacement take?
The time required for ignition replacement can differ however normally takes between 1 to 3 hours, depending upon the lorry's make and model.
2. Will my car start if the ignition is malfunctioning?
In many cases, a faulty ignition system might prevent the car from starting entirely. However, there may be events where the engine begins periodically before failing entirely.
3. How can I prolong the life of my ignition system?
To make sure durability, think about the following pointers:
Regular Maintenance: Schedule routine check-ups, consisting of stimulate plug replacement and ignition coil examination.Use Quality Fuel: Poor quality fuel can result in engine knocking and ignition problems.Address Warning Signs Early: Address any alerting lights or performance concerns immediately.4. Is ignition replacement covered under warranty?
Lots of new vehicles featured service warranties that may cover ignition system issues. Verify the specifics of your guarantee documents for protection.
5. What are the threats of delaying ignition replacement?
Delaying replacement can lead to more extreme engine concerns, increased repair expenses, and possible safety hazards if the vehicle stalls suddenly while driving.
